v Communalism – PublicknowledgeCultureofTheUniversity CultureofIndustry

v Proprietary – aslittleasnecessaryismadepublic

Thedifferencebetweenacademicandindustrialscience,Dr.ShawnCunningham,2011

v Skepticism – requirescriticalscrutiny,debate,peerreviewandcontradiction

v Disinterestedness – neutralandimpersonaljudgement

v Originality – newcontributionstoexistingknowledge

v Universalism – scientificfindingsareevaluatedobjectivelyregardlessofranksorstatus

v Authoritarian – actingwithinahierarchyintheworkplace

v Local – focusedonlocaltechnicalproblems

v Expert – expertproblemsolvingratherthancreativity

v Commissioned – toachievespecificpracticalgoals(ROI)

CulturalGap
